|
@@ -948,7 +948,6 @@ public class MarkServiceImpl implements MarkService {
|
|
|
* @param group
|
|
|
*/
|
|
|
private void resetGroup(MarkGroup group) {
|
|
|
- groupDao.resetCount(group.getExamId(), group.getSubjectCode(), group.getNumber());
|
|
|
if (group.getStatus() == MarkStatus.FORMAL) {
|
|
|
trackDao.deleteByExamIdAndSubjectCodeAndGroupNumber(group.getExamId(), group.getSubjectCode(),
|
|
|
group.getNumber());
|
|
@@ -968,6 +967,8 @@ public class MarkServiceImpl implements MarkService {
|
|
|
trialHistoryDao.deleteByExamIdAndSubjectCodeAndGroupNumber(group.getExamId(), group.getSubjectCode(),
|
|
|
group.getNumber());
|
|
|
}
|
|
|
+ updateLibraryCount(group);
|
|
|
+ groupDao.resetCount(group.getExamId(), group.getSubjectCode(), group.getNumber());
|
|
|
releaseByGroup(group);
|
|
|
}
|
|
|
|